On the restrictors ..
1)Moroso #22050 restrictor kits (2 required, need of small only)
2)I NEED to drill the mentioned 0.062" small holes IN THE Morose RESTRICTOR correct? So the cam will see only oil via these small holes?
3) need to drill holes FOR the Restrictors (boring the oil pipe towards the cam for the restrictors) to fit in block. What SIZE to drill? (not sure if my machine shop has ever done this)
3) Restrictors will go in all 5 mains on the oiling pipe towards the cam
(#1 needs to go decently deep, as there is a kind of T-shape pipe set up in the block
(need to go beyond the horizontal tube to restrict the flow towards the cam only)
. (#2-#5 are easy as direct off the main journal seats
(there is some confusion to me, as looking to George Reid's book p 57 on the set up from Tim Meyer the text is confusing Confused as least I could not get it)

4) Tapped bore bushings, need to see if the machine shop can do this with their tools otherwise would need to order the full set but costly as need to ad 20% VAT.
Where can I get the bushings from? Wydendorf only?
